Interpretation
The song "Florenz" by
Pashanim describes his experiences and thoughts on his path to success. He mentions how he drives through Tuscany in a luxurious Prada shirt and hears Moroccans calling out to him. He emphasizes how his life has improved and his mother no longer has to worry. Pashanim also talks about his past selling drugs to make ends meet and how he is now successful as a musician. He mentions the recognition he receives from fans and even from Prada cashiers. Despite his success, he emphasizes the importance of his roots and his relationship with his loved ones. The chorus of the song, where he walks through Florence, symbolizes his path of progress and growth. He reflects on his past, his love, and questions whether he is accepted by others as he truly is. In "Florenz," Pashanim shows his development from humble beginnings to a successful artist and reflects on the importance of authenticity, love, and gratitude on his journey.
